Native plant species are those that naturally occur in a specific area and typically have not been introduced through human intervention. They have evolved over time, are hearty and usually more insect and disease resistant. Habitat preservation and soil and water conservation is the guiding principal behind using native plants. They create a landscape that looks natural and usually functions with minimal care. Using native plants in landscaping helps sustain wildlife and provide food and shelter for them.
